Act 3 - Spoilers One fight is much harder if you skip the crèche Spoiler

2.1k Upvotes

On this playthrough, I decided to skip the crèche. This meant I never met Voss (never went to the bridge in act 1), never met the inquisitor, and I was not ambushed by a githyanki patrol on my way to Baldur's gate in act 2. Cool.

But when going to the Elfsong's basement to check out the Emperor's hideout, I met githyanki there as expected. But I did not expect both the inquisitor with his legendary action and the patrol leader (that blasts 6 eldritch blasts) to be there along with the usual crew...

Wow.

That could have ended my honour run, but I managed to get one character out and resurrect two companions (not easy with fear dealt left and right and astral step).

Anyhow, that was fun. 10/10 would recommend. But maybe not if you are worried of loosing your honour run (I wasn't too worried since I already have the achievement).

Act 1 - Spoilers Killed the druids, lost no tieflings Spoiler

Upvotes

Characters on level 3, playing on Normal, took several hours of attempts. you have to split into 3 groups, one attacks Arron the trader, one stays out of range on the stairs down to the circle, and one steals the idol. trigger the cutscene, switch to whoevers on the stairs, and immediately activate turn based mode to pause anyone running up the stairs, switch groups and attack Arron, then immediately switch back to whoever’s on the stairs, the game will have taken you out of turn based mode, turn it on again, kagha and them should be frozen in time running out of the basement, use your first action in the group that stole the idol to attack kagha, turning her “temporarily hostile” and bringing her into combat, the druids never make it up the stairs and there’s no fight between druids and tieflings except the small group that attacks arron with you.

it helps to have killed nettie and the other elf in the separate rooms in the basement, and you can kill jeorna and mino and the bear at the bottom of the stairs with a smokepowder bomb without triggering the cutscene if you’re careful, which does make the big fight significantly easier
